| Thanks Rich! Did a little with Red today. Got my universal shaft in today. Looks like it will slip straight onto the end of the stock steering shaft. That makes things a little easier. I took the gear off the end and cut a notch around just below the frame mount and reinstalled the snap ring there. I also ran bolts through the frame brace and used locking washers to connect the bottom a bit more securely than before.  I also re-threaded the dash plate and ran bolts up there too instead of the self tappers.  Red is starting to come together.  I did weld the stub onto the rack for the universal. I do think it will hit after all. The more I look at the front monolink the more I do not like it. | Finally got a chance to go all the way through this thread. Really liking the progress you've made. The best way to not burn through thin metal is practice and patience. Sometimes you only want to weld an inch at a time and then stop and wait til you can't see the metal glowing through your helmet lens and then go another inch, stop, etc. Once you've done this long enough you'll get a feel(or an ear) for when to start and stop. Even with my mig I do this when welding really thin stuff like propane cans or exhausts. You'll even get the hang of filling holes eventually. It's all practice. I usually don't label my stuff.
